.c-media {
- margin: 0 auto;
+ margin: 0 auto;
+
+ .only-s {
+ .l-button--fav {
+ margin-top: -10px;
+ }
+ }
}
.c-media__actions {
- display: flex;
+ display: flex;
+ column-gap: 38px;
+ row-gap: 10px;
}
.c-media__btn {
text-align: center;
align-items: center;
- &:nth-child(1) { padding-right: 19px; }
- &:nth-child(2) { padding-left: 19px; padding-right: 19px; }
- &:nth-child(3) { padding-left: 19px; }
+ //&:nth-child(1) { padding-right: 19px; }
+ //&:nth-child(2) { padding-left: 19px; padding-right: 19px; }
+ //&:nth-child(3) { padding-left: 19px; }
.l-button {
width: 100%;
background: #F2F2F2;
padding: 15px 24px;
border-radius: 0 0 5px 5px;
- max-width: 830px;
margin: 0 auto;
display: flex;
align-items: center;
z-index: 10;
top: 0;
left: 0;
- width: 100%;
height: 100%;
- align-items: center;
+ align-items: flex-start;
justify-content: center;
background-color: rgba($color-black, 0.35);
display: none;
+ overflow-y: scroll;
+ padding: 10vh 40px 40px 40px;
+ width: 100%;
&.is-open {
display: flex;
opacity: 1;
}
}
+
+.book-cover-small img {
+ max-width: calc((100vw - 3 * 16px) / 2);
+}